This image captures a bustling street market scene in Nyanya, Nigeria, during what appears to be the late afternoon or early morning, indicated by the long shadows on the dusty ground. The setting is an outdoor, unpaved market space, characteristic of local commerce.

The scene is dominated by various agricultural products and numerous individuals engaged in trade. In the foreground and extending through the midground, large quantities of root vegetables are displayed. These include long, brown yams piled directly on the ground and lighter, rounder tubers, likely sweet potatoes or taro (cocoyams), arranged in black plastic basins and woven baskets. Smaller green citrus fruits, possibly limes or small oranges, are presented in decorative ceramic bowls and bright plastic bowls (green and orange). Some lighter round fruits are also visible on a mat in the background.

Several people are visible in various states of activity. On the far left, a person in a blue and white striped shirt and cap is bent over, attending to produce. Central to the frame, a woman in a blue and white top with a patterned skirt stands near the yam displays. Further back, another woman, wearing a purple headscarf and a patterned dress, is actively selecting items from a ground display. To the right, a man in a blue t-shirt and dark cap is bent over, handling multiple blue and black plastic bags, possibly bagging customer purchases. The front wheel, headlight, and handlebars of a red and silver motorcycle are prominent on the right, with a person's legs (clad in dark trousers and sandals) standing beside it, suggesting a customer or vendor using the vehicle for transport. Other blurred figures populate the background, contributing to the lively market ambiance.

Visible text details include "COMF" partially seen on a white bag on the left, and a fragmented "POS" sign in the distant background, possibly indicating a "Point of Sale" service. The overall impression is one of everyday commerce and community activity in a vibrant local marketplace.
